From: Mark Mitchell Date: Thu, 3 May 2001 16:14:34 +0000 (+0000) Subject: integrate.h (struct inline_remap): Add leaf_reg_map table. X-Git-Url: https://git.libre-soc.org/?a=commitdiff_plain;h=c826ae21755f71ba6607714f97fab37ae0cfacae;p=gcc.git integrate.h (struct inline_remap): Add leaf_reg_map table. * integrate.h (struct inline_remap): Add leaf_reg_map table. * integrate.c (expand_inline_function): Use xcalloc to allocate memory. (copy_rtx_and_substitute): Use the leaf_reg_map for leaf registers.
